14 Feb Professor of Integral Hydraulic Engineering
The objective of the chair of Integral Hydraulic Engineering is to enhance the knowledge related to hydraulic structures and to contribute to the dissemination of such knowledge. Hydraulic structures are structures built to defend land against floods and droughts, to regulate water for agriculture and industry, to provide infrastructure for waterborne and water-related transport and to make use of water as a source of energy. The complexity and uniqueness of hydraulic structures, together with the uncertainties in loads and resistance, require a conceptual and integral approach to optimise the design of these structures. This offers a new perspective involving sustainability, ecodesign, multidisciplinary use of space, adaptability, life cycle management, scale enlargement and the application of new materials and shapes. The advancement of probabilistic design methods is required to develop reliability methods for the design and maintenance of hydraulic structures.
